Sandrine Rousseau's hunting rifles: the story of a hoax

It's the opening of the hunting season! And some game weighs more than others. On September 21, the first hearing of the trial of Sandrine Rousseau, prosecuted criminally by the National Federation of Hunters, will take place.

The facts date back to February 22, 2022. On the set of the show “Les 4 Vérités” on France 2, our national ecofeminist gets carried away:

“It is not a hobby to go and kill animals on the weekend with guns. And […] the rest of the week, we can also point it at his wife. We have seen that one in four femicides is linked to a hunting weapon, one in four femicides! »

According to almost all media, Sandrine Rousseau would draw thisall statistics from the website of the collective “Femicides by spouse or ex-spouse”, which counts spousal murders committed in France.

... and it is totally wrong. The statistics " 1/4 of femicides committed by hunting weapons » does not appear anywhere on their site: and their data even indicates a much lower figure.

S. Rousseau only takes up false information due to two anti-hunting activists: Camille Leguillon known as “Ollune” and Moran Kerinec, freelancer at Reporterre/Slate.

How did we get here? This is an opportunity to dive into the strange world of woke conspiracy theories. We will "learn" that the government distributes rifles to hunters and covers up their crimes, and that justice and the media knowingly organize a " omerta » around femicides. ..

We will see above all how two obscure activists can rig a figure immediately swallowed by politicians and the media, with little or no verification.

Act I: An anti-speciesist falsifies the figures of the “Fémincide” collective

Our story begins on November 9, 2021 on the Instagram account of Camille Leguillon known as “Ollune Cilimaleg”, anti-speciesist and especially anti-hunting activist, member of the collective “Abolissons La Vénerie”

That day, a driver is accidentally killed by a hunter. Immediately, anti-speciesist circles use this as a pretext to demand the abolition of hunting, a sport that is " meurtrier » practiced by a « armed minority »From« real weapons of war "!

Alas for them, The figures clearly show that hunting, which is very regulated, is extremely safe. : accident statistics are similar to those of horse riding[1].

But our activist Ollune has found a solution: to inflate the figure, she will add... homicides committed with hunting weapons.

This is already absurd: if a madman murders his neighbor by running him over with his car, is it a "traffic accident"? This is confusing deliberate abuse and accidents due to use. But Ollune wants at all costs a security pretext to save Bambi... and will go so far as to defraud to obtain it, as we will see.

Ollune is an illustrator: she details her research in a nice instagram slideshow with the sensationalist title: our exhibit #1.

(EDIT: Ollune deleted his slideshow, but you can find it again here)

The shape and colors are going to be very girly, the bottom less. Ollune will quickly fall into a rather worrying conspiracy.

She first addresses the Ministry of the Interior… which obviously does not have this absurd figure. When he learns it, Ollune explodes. It can't be a coincidence: They were asked to hide the truth me on deadly hunters!

Ollune will insist: not only does the government carefully avoid " dissect "(sic) homicide statistics - meaning: he protects hunters. But he even goes so far as to distribute guns to them!

Faced with the guilty silence of the ministry, Ollune decides to change his method.
She will extrapolate her figure from the statistics... of femicides.
But not just any: those of “Femicides by spouse or ex-spouse” collective

We quickly understand why our anti-speciesist finds it " unbelievable ": The Femicides collective follows the same conspiracy line as Ollune. Every procedural delay, every off-key word from a journalist... is taken as proof of the "complicity" of the press and the justice system in hiding femicides.

A journalist mentions a possible suicide instead of a murder? This is the #complicitpress[2]... A magistrate refuses (logically) to comment on a current case? We shout at the #accomplicejustice and #OMERTA[3]. Does AFP keep a more objective count?Accomplice " too[4] !

The collective's "count" is indeed determined to include the "tragedies of old age" (suicides of elderly and sick couples) as well as femicides, even when letters attest to the contraryMagistrates and journalists who dare to mention them are obviously “accomplices”…

Ollune then “peels” the 2020 data from the Femicides collective. Out of 107 murders (104 femicides and 3 collateral victims)[5], it counts 26 kills by hunting rifle: or approximately 25%.

The figure “1/4 of femicides are due to hunting rifles” was born.

... but by redoing the count of Ollune, we only find 11 deaths instead of 26! My data is available here. What happened? A mistake is very unlikely, just read the table. Add 1 or 2 carelessly, maybe… but almost triple the number?

There is no longer any doubt: Ollune simply inflated the figure from 11 to 26.

And we can see why it was tempting: Ollune will then extrapolate this percentage to all homicides committed in France with… a beast rule of three – a statistician would scream. Writing “26 femicides” instead of “11” would therefore be multiplying the total number of people killed by hunting weapons by… 236%. Hard to resist![6]

Let's summarize: Ollune makes us believe that the count of the collective "Femicides..." counts not 11 deaths by firearms, but 26... or 1/4 of the total number of femicides. And we will see the press blindly repeat this figure without ever thinking of verifying it at the source.

Act III: Sandrine Rousseau announcement the figure to the media

Three months later, Sandrine Rousseau is on the set of "Les 4 Vérités" on France 2. It's an opportunity to practice a old recipe of feminism Woke : to bring out the most outrageous accusation possible against an eternal culprit (White, heterosexual) or a unprotected minority (practicing Catholics, rural people, here hunters).

The effect is twofold: first, you create buzz without risk by attacking a group that cannot defend itself; second, you mobilize your own activists. Woke. The technique is well known at EELV: think of Caroline de Haas and Alice Coffin – « we must eliminate men from our lives », etc.

Seen from this angle, “1/4 of femicides are due to hunting weapons” is the ideal little phrase. It is not the poor million hunters who will be able to defend themselves against this in the media. And the faction " ecofeminist » (anti-speciesists and feminists) woke) by Sandrine Rousseau will be delighted, a few months before the necessary mobilization for the presidential elections.

Madame Rousseau therefore comes out with her sentence… with the expected success : rural people are outraged (and powerless), anti-hunting people are exultant… and all the media are talking about it.

However, only one person will decide to check the figure: TF1. And this is the most scandalous moment of the whole affair.

The journalist is unlikely to detect the fraud: as a fact-check, he will… literally copy Mr. Kerinec’s article., which took up Ollune's rigged statistics and attributed them to the collective "Femicides...".

Better! He then appropriates his sources (the scientists Alexa Delbreil and Jean-Louis Senon), presenting them as if he had found them alone. And, as a final kick in the ass, deigns to cite the Reporterre article, from which he has just plundered 80% of the content, for the remaining meager 20%.[9]… let this serve as a lesson to Mr. Kerinec: you can always find someone more dishonest than yourself.

The case came to light again on August 25, when it was announced that the FNC had filed a complaint. No other media (France TV News, Ouest-France...) will then verify the figures attributed to the Femicides collective

Some will even add inaccurate facts.. Rémy Dodet of Le Nouvel Observateur thus affirms that the collective corroborates its figures with " statistics official »

Nothing like this appears on the website of the “Femicide” collective… and for good reason! We have seen how distrustful there are of "complicit" institutions.

This additional inaccuracy (which contributes to giving credibility to S. Rousseau's rigged statistic) will also be taken up as is by the Huffington Post a few hours later...
